ALEXANDRIA, Va., Feb. 17 -- United States Patent no. 12,554,814, issued on Feb. 17, was assigned to Telefonaktiebolaget LM Ericsson (Publ) (Stockholm).

"Authorization using an optical sensor" was invented by Alexander Hunt (Tygelsjo, Sweden), Andreas Kristensson (Sodra Sandby, Sweden), Fredrik Dahlgren (Lund, Sweden) and Magnus Olsson (Klagshamn, Sweden).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A method of authorizing a device action includes accessing a first baseline model that represents image characteristics of an authorized first user or object.
